Web1 Nov 2024 · A DMA controller can, in theory, write one byte of RAM per clock cycle. So, at most, it could update the system memory at 1 megabyte per second. Can you do full motion video with DMA? Absolutely. A hires graphic screen is 9K of data (8K for pixels and 1K for color). At 30 frames per second, that would be 270 kilobytes for one second of video. To review, open the file in an editor that reveals hidden Unicode … Web5 Oct 2024 · ScyllaDB and AIO/DIO. With ScyllaDB, we have chosen the highest performing option, AIO/DIO. To isolate some of the complexity involved, we wrote Seastar, a high-performance framework for I/O intensive applications. Seastar abstracts away the details of performing AIO and provides common APIs for network, disk, and multi-core …
